Understanding Spinal Anatomy Disorders

The human spinal cord is a complex and vital part of the body's central nervous system. It plays a crucial role in facilitating communication between the brain and the rest of the body. However, various disorders can affect the anatomy of the spinal cord, leading to significant health issues. Understanding the causes, symptoms, and treatments of spinal anatomy disorders is essential for promoting awareness and ensuring timely intervention.

Penyebab (Causes) of Gangguan Anatomi Spinal

Spinal anatomy disorders can arise from a variety of causes, including traumatic injuries, congenital abnormalities, degenerative conditions, and infections. Traumatic injuries, such as fractures or dislocations of the vertebrae, can directly impact the spinal cord, leading to functional impairments. Congenital abnormalities, such as spina bifida, result from incomplete development of the spinal cord and its protective covering. Degenerative conditions, including spinal stenosis and herniated discs, can gradually affect the spinal anatomy over time. Additionally, infections, such as meningitis or abscesses, can also contribute to spinal anatomy disorders.

Gejala (Symptoms) of Gangguan Anatomi Spinal

The symptoms of spinal anatomy disorders can vary widely depending on the specific condition and its severity. Common symptoms may include localized or radiating pain, numbness or tingling sensations, muscle weakness, and impaired coordination. In more severe cases, individuals may experience loss of bladder or bowel control, paralysis, or sensory deficits. It is important to note that the symptoms of spinal anatomy disorders can significantly impact an individual's quality of life and functional abilities, emphasizing the need for prompt recognition and management.

Pengobatan (Treatment) of Gangguan Anatomi Spinal

The treatment of spinal anatomy disorders aims to alleviate symptoms, prevent further damage, and restore optimal function whenever possible. Depending on the underlying cause, treatment approaches may include conservative measures, such as physical therapy, pain management, and bracing. In cases of severe trauma or structural abnormalities, surgical intervention may be necessary to stabilize the spine, decompress the spinal cord, or address deformities. Additionally, ongoing medical monitoring and rehabilitation are essential components of comprehensive treatment plans for spinal anatomy disorders.
